xkai 补了一下截图,测试是VM5兼容性+二进制转换。VT-x和VT-x/EPT都可以正常启动
这个跟host OS和VM版本&VM兼容性版本无关,i5 7400+Win7一模一样的提示,i3 6100+Win7/10用任何虚拟化引擎都正常
14开始就不能选择虚拟化引擎了,主机不开虚拟化的话虚拟机都开不了


VM老版本的默认虚拟化引擎取决于设置的Guest OS,以Win为例,低于XP的是二进制转换,XP以上的是虚拟化接口
所以在上面的测试中,Guest OS选98,虚拟化引擎选自动和二进制转换都会报错,只能要么把虚拟化引擎改为带虚拟化那俩,要么把Guest OS选为至少XP
提示原文:二进制转换与该平台上的长模式不兼容。如果客户机进入长模式,虚拟化引擎将自动切换至 Intel VT-x。
然后是报错:
VMware Workstation 不可恢复错误: (vcpu-0)
vcpu-0:VERIFY vmcore/vmm/main/cpuid.c:386 bugNr=1036521
日志文件位于XXX中。
您可以请求支持。
要收集数据提交给 VMware 技术支持,请选择“帮助”菜单中的“收集支持数据”。
也可以直接在 Workstation 文件夹中运行“vm-support”脚本。
我们将根据您的技术支持权利做出回应。
此提示网上的solution都是主机开启虚拟化,然后改虚拟化引擎,没一个说出原因的。(可想而知这些人都没意识到新u的问题)
日志如下
查了一下,最早16年10月就有帖子说这个了,当时kaby只发了低压,ryzen1还没发